Apple iPhone 12 Mini and iPhone 12 Pro Max now up for pre-order in India, starting at INR 69,900

Apple has launched its iPhone 12 series a few weeks ago and unveiled the four models of this iPhone 12 series: iPhone 12, iPhone 12 Mini, iPhone 12 Pro, and iPhone 12 Pro Max. Among those iPhones, iPhone 12 and iPhone 12 Pro were made available for retail. As of now, another piece of news has come in the market that iPhone 12 mini and iPhone 12 Pro Max are now available from pre-orders.

If we check out the pricing, the iPhone 12 mini variant’s price tag starts at $699 and the Pro Max variant’s pricing starts at $1,099. Apple is trying to make these devices available in multiple countries across the globe. As per the reports, the pre-order of these iPhones are launching in more than 50 countries and regions. Not only this but also Brazil, South Korea, and other regions’ customers will be able to grab this deal of pre-orders from 20th November.

Other than that, from today (6th November), you can pre-order iPhone 12 mini and 12 Pro Max. But the shipping of both the iPhones will start on 13th November. Monthly payment modes are available as well. Apart from these, HomePod Mini pre-orders are also available for pre-orders in Australia, Canada, France, Germany, Hong Kong, India, Japan, Spain, the UK, and the US whereas the shipping will start around November 16.

Let’s just check out the pricing of the different variants of iPhone 12 mini and iPhone 12 Pro Max.

iPhone 12 Mini Pricing

  • 64 GB Storage: $699 | INR 74,990
  • 128 GB Storage: $749 | INR 69,990
  • 256 GB Storage: $849

iPhone 12 Pro Max Pricing

  • 128 GB Storage: $1,099 | INR 1,29,900
  • 256 GB Storage: $1,199 | INR 1,39,990
  • 512 GB Storage:  $1,399
